  1. Sasheer Zamata Moore (/ s ə ˈ ʃ ɪər z ə ˈ m eɪ t ə /; born May 6, 1986) is an American actress and stand-up comedian. She is best known for her tenure as a cast member on the NBC sketch comedy series Saturday Night Live from 2014 to 2017.
